הדרכות

אפליקציית GitHub Copilot: שולחן הפיקוד לעידן שבו סוכנים כותבים את הקוד

GitHub השיקה אפליקציית דסקטופ ילידת-סוכנים שמרכזת ריצות AI מרובות במקום אחד. בדקתי מה זה אומר על התפקיד שלנו כמתכנתים.

אפליקציית GitHub Copilot: שולחן הפיקוד לעידן שבו סוכנים כותבים את הקוד

"מסתבר ש-GitHub כבר לא בנתה לנו עורך קוד — היא בנתה לנו שולחן פיקוד." זה המשפט שרץ לי בראש כשקראתי על אפליקציית GitHub Copilot שהוצגה ב-Microsoft Build 2026 והושקה באופן כללי (GA — General Availability, כלומר זמינה לכולם, לא רק לבטא) ב-17 ביוני 2026 ל-Windows, macOS ו-Linux.

בעיניי זה אחד הרגעים שבהם הכלי עצמו מסגיר לאן הולך המקצוע. בואו נפרק את זה לאט, ובלי באזז.

מה זה בכלל "אפליקציית Copilot", ולמה היא לא עוד עורך קוד

נתחיל בהגדרה נקייה. אפליקציית GitHub Copilot היא חוויית דסקטופ ילידת-סוכנים (agent-native) שמאפשרת להשיק, לפקח, לאמת ולשלח (ship) ריצות קוד של סוכני AI עבור מפתחים שעובדים על כמה משימות בו-זמנית.

עכשיו, מה זה "ילידת-סוכנים"? תחשבו על ההבדל בין מכונית עם בקרת שיוט לבין חדר בקרה של תנועה. עורך קוד רגיל בנוי סביב ההנחה שיש מתכנת אחד שמקליד שורה-שורה, ובצד יש לו עוזר חכם. אפליקציה ילידת-סוכנים הופכת את היוצרות: ההנחה הבסיסית היא שיש כמה סוכנים שעובדים במקביל, והמתכנת האנושי הוא זה שמפקח עליהם, מאשר ומכוון. הסוכן הוא לא תוסף — הוא יחידת העבודה.

הקטע המדליק הוא ש-GitHub לא מסתירה את זה. הם בנו תצוגה אחת בשם "My Work" שמרכזת את כל הריצות הפעילות (sessions), את ה-issues (משימות ובאגים פתוחים), את ה-pull requests וגם אוטומציות רקע — והכל על פני כל הריפוז (repositories, מאגרי הקוד) המחוברים. במקום לקפוץ בין עשרה טאבים, יש לנו מסך פיקוד אחד.

worktree: למה שני סוכנים לא דורסים אחד את השני

כאן מגיע הפרט ההנדסי שאני הכי אהבתי, כי הוא חכם ושקט. כל session רץ ב-git worktree משלו.

מה זה worktree? בלי להיכנס לפנים-מעיים של git, נסביר בפשטות. כשאנחנו עובדים על קוד, אנחנו עובדים על "ענף" (branch) — גרסת עבודה מבודדת. בקיצור, worktree הוא עותק מבודד של הענף, תיקיית עבודה נפרדת לגמרי, שיושבת לצד האחרות. תחשבו על זה כמו שולחנות נפרדים במטבח מקצועי: לכל טבח יש משטח משלו עם הרכיבים שלו, וכך שניים שמכינים מנות שונות לא נתקלים זה בכלים של זה.

למה זה משנה לנו? כי בלי בידוד כזה, שני סוכנים שעובדים במקביל על אותו ריפו פשוט היו דורסים אחד את הקבצים של השני — מה שאנחנו קוראים לו התנגשות (conflict). ה-worktree לכל session הוא הדבר שהופך "סוכנים מקבילים" מבאסה תיאורטית לדבר שבאמת אפשר להריץ.

Agent Merge ו-Canvases: מאיפה האדם נכנס לתמונה

עכשיו שיש לנו צוות סוכנים שעובד, צריך לשלב את העבודה שלהם בחזרה לקוד הראשי. כאן נכנס Agent Merge.

בואו נסגור מושג בסיסי קודם. PR (Pull Request) הוא בקשה לשלב שינוי קוד מענף אחד לתוך הקוד הראשי — כמו להגיש מאמר למערכת לפני שהוא עולה לאתר. merge הוא הפעולה של השילוב עצמו. Agent Merge הוא הפיצ'ר שמעביר PR אוטומטית דרך שלושה שערים: review (סקירת קוד), בדיקות (tests — קוד שבודק שהקוד עובד) ותנאי מרג' שאנחנו מגדירים. רק אם הכל ירוק — זה נכנס.

ויש עוד שכבה שאני חושב שהיא הלב האנושי של כל הסיפור: "Canvases". אלה משטחים דו-כיווניים שבהם מפתחים אנושיים וסוכנים מתערבים ישירות באותה עבודה. זה לא "תן לסוכן הוראה ולך לישון" — זה לעמוד מול אותו לוח ולצייר עליו ביחד. בעיניי זו ההודאה הכי כנה של GitHub בכך שהאדם נשאר בלולאה, לא בתור צופה אלא בתור שותף פעיל.

השוואה

עורך קוד קלאסי מול אפליקציה ילידת-סוכנים

Sandbox: למה אנחנו נותנים לסוכנים לרוץ בלי לפחד

יש פה שאלה שכל אחד ששמע "AI שמריץ קוד לבד" שואל מיד: ומה אם זה ימחק לי דברים? התשובה של GitHub היא sandbox — ארגז חול.

מה זה sandbox? סביבה מבודדת ומוגבלת עם אכיפת מדיניות, שבה הקוד יכול לרוץ בלי לגעת בשאר המערכת. תחשבו על זה כמו ארגז חול אמיתי בגן שעשועים: הילד יכול לחפור, לבנות ולהרוס כמה שבא לו, אבל הבלגן נשאר בתוך הארגז. האפליקציה מציעה שני סוגים: sandboxing מקומי (על המחשב שלנו, עם מדיניות אכיפה) וסביבות ענן ארעיות — סביבות לינוקס זמניות מבית GitHub שקמות, עושות את העבודה ונעלמות.

למה זה משנה לנו? כי בידוד הוא מה שמאפשר לנו להוריד את היד מההגה. בלי ארגז חול, "תן לסוכן להריץ" זה הימור; עם ארגז חול, זו החלטה הנדסית שקולה.

ה-SDK: זה לא רק אפליקציה, זו תשתית

נקודה אחרונה וחשובה, כי היא משנה את הסקייל של הסיפור. במקביל לאפליקציה, ה-Copilot SDK הפך זמין כללית (GA).

מה זה SDK? ראשי התיבות הם Software Development Kit — ערכת כלים שמאפשרת לנו, המפתחים, לבנות בעצמנו על גבי המנוע של GitHub במקום רק להשתמש באפליקציה המוכנה. וה-SDK הזה יצא בבת אחת ל-Node/TypeScript, Python, Go, .NET, Rust ו-Java. השפה שלנו כבר נתמכת, כנראה.

המשמעות, לפי ה-CPO (Chief Product Officer, סמנכ"ל המוצר) מריו רודריגז, היא ש-GitHub לא מוכרת רק מוצר — היא מוכרת פלטפורמה. כל אחד יכול לבנות את ה"שולחן פיקוד" שלו.

צעד אחר צעד

איך ריצת סוכן עוברת מרעיון לקוד ראשי

1

השקה ב-session

מריצים סוכן על משימה — והוא מקבל git worktree משלו, עותק ענף מבודד שלא מתנגש באחרים.

1 / 4

אז מה זה אומר עלינו — בעיניי

שורה תחתונה, ואני אומר את זה בתור מישהו שבדק את הפיצ'רים אחד-אחד: התפקיד שלנו זז. אנחנו עוברים מ"כותבי קוד" ל"מנהלי צוות סוכנים".

תחשבו על זה כמו על ראש-צוות פיתוח. ראש-צוות טוב לא בהכרח מקליד הכי מהר — הוא יודע לחלק משימות, להגדיר תנאי קבלה ברורים (וזה בדיוק Agent Merge), לתת לכל אחד מרחב עבודה משלו (worktree), לדאוג שאף אחד לא ישבור את הסביבה (sandbox), ולשבת עם הצוות מול הלוח ברגעים הקריטיים (Canvases). המיומנות החדשה היא לא מהירות הקלדה — היא איכות הפיקוח וההגדרה.

ואני חייב להיות הוגן ולסייג. אפליקציה אחת, חדשה, שהושקה לפני פחות משבועיים, היא לא הוכחה שהעולם השתנה — היא הימור מחושב של חברה גדולה אחת על כיוון מסוים. יש גישות אחרות לאותו אתגר (סוכנים בטרמינל, סוכנים בענן בלבד, סוכנים מובנים בעורך הקיים), וכל אחת עושה איזון אחר בין שליטה לאוטונומיה. עוד מוקדם להגיד מי צודק. מה שכן ברור לי: הכלים כבר מניחים שאנחנו מנהלים, לא רק מקלידים. ואת המיומנות הזו — של פיקוח, הגדרה ואמון מבוקר בסוכנים — כדאי לנו להתחיל לאמן כבר עכשיו.

אז אני שואל אתכם: כשהסוכנים כותבים את הקוד, מה הופך אותנו עדיין למתכנתים טובים — ומה אנחנו מתאמנים עליו השבוע?

אמ;לק

5 הדברים שצריך לדעת

GitHub השיקה ב-17.6.2026 (GA, ל-Windows/macOS/Linux) סביבה שבה משיקים, מפקחים, מאמתים ושולחים ריצות קוד של סוכני AI — תצוגת My Work אחת לכל הריפוז.

כל session רץ ב-git worktree משלו (עותק ענף מבודד) כדי שסוכנים מקבילים לא יתנגשו, ו-sandbox מקומי או ענן ארעי נותן לקוד לרוץ בבטחה.

Agent Merge מעביר PR דרך review, בדיקות ותנאי מרג'; Canvases הם משטחים דו-כיווניים שבהם אדם וסוכן עובדים יחד ישירות.

ה-Copilot SDK יצא GA ל-Node/TypeScript, Python, Go, .NET, Rust ו-Java — כל אחד יכול לבנות את שולחן הפיקוד שלו.

בעיניי המעבר הוא מ'כותב קוד' ל'מנהל צוות סוכנים' — המיומנות החדשה היא איכות פיקוח והגדרה, לא מהירות הקלדה.

פניות תקשורת

לראיונות, שיתופי פעולה והרצאות — נשמח לדבר.

info@yuv.ai